High-index-contrast, wide-FSR microring-resonator filter design and realization with frequency-shift compensation

Abstract

Rigorous electromagnetic simulations are used to design high-index-contrast microring-resonator filters. The first fabricated third-order filters compensated for passband distortion due to coupling-induced and fabrication-related frequency shifts demonstrate a 20nm FSR and the highest reported thru-port extinction (14dB).
